I decided on the Minelab SE and Im going for it very soon. It will be a big jump from my BH SS II. I will be using the stock coil for most cases but I want to be ready with an additional coil for trashy and tight areas right away.
Would like suggestions on smaller coils that go deep and good for trashy areas for the SE. Thanks

I'm using the SunRay 8" and I'm liking it re-al bad. I'll probably pick up the 5" in the next few months, but I think the 8" is a great recommendation.
I've been reading great things about 4.5x7" coils as well. Too bad SunRay doesn't make any of those. DB |

Thanks for the input Sunray it is then. Do you guys use the Sunray 5.5" in all conditions trashy or not, or do you switch to the smaller coil only if you find yourself in a trashy area?
I can only go with one spare coil at this time so was wondering if the 8" would be a good all around replacement for the stock coil to use in all conditions trashy or not. Or get the 5.5" use the stock coil most times and switch to 5.5" when in trashy area only.
